    Features of mycobiota of plasterboard constructions in premises with different operating conditions

    There is a significant deterioration of mycological condition of premises with modern interiors synthetic materials, including plasterboard which have significant demand. The aim was to determine the species, which are specific to plasterboard and damage it under operating conditions. Microscopic fungi were isolated from samples of plasterboard and air in homes that had signs of excessive moisture and office premises with no signs of moisture. Methods of cumulative culture and serial dilutions on agar nutrient media were used to isolate fungi in pure culture. Frequency of occurrence of fungal species for mycobiota of individual premises was calculated. Thus, mycobiota of plasterboard constructions was investigated in different premises; it was represented by 25 species of microscopic fungi belonging to 12 genera of Ascomycota division. It was established that the number of species of microscopic fungi, that are contaminants of plasterboard in conditions of excessive moisture areas, far exceeds the average rate for premises with no signs of moisture. It was shown that in climates of Kyiv main contaminants of plasterboard constructions are species Stachybotrys chartarum, Aspergillus niger, A. sydowii, A. versicolor, A. ustus and Sarocladium strictum, which are hazardous to health and life of humans and warm-blooded animals
